About this course

In today's world, there is an increasing demand for professionals who can effectively measure and analyze the impact of humanitarian responses. This course meets this industry need by providing learners with practical skills to design and implement monitoring and evaluation frameworks, collect and analyze data, and communicate findings to various stakeholders. By completing this program, learners will be able to demonstrate their ability to contribute to evidence-based decision-making in the humanitarian sector, making them highly valuable to organizations involved in humanitarian response and recovery efforts. With a focus on real-world application and practical skills, this course is an excellent opportunity for learners to advance their careers in the humanitarian sector while making a positive impact on the lives of people affected by crises and disasters.

Course Details

• Introduction to Humanitarian Monitoring & Evaluation
• Principles of Humanitarian Aid & Assistance
• Data Collection Methods in Humanitarian Contexts
• Designing Monitoring & Evaluation Frameworks for Humanitarian Programs
• Performance Indicators in Humanitarian Monitoring & Evaluation
• Data Analysis for Humanitarian M&E
• Report Writing & Communication for Humanitarian M&E
• Ethics in Humanitarian Monitoring & Evaluation
• Digital Tools & Innovations in Humanitarian M&E

Career Path

The Humanitarian Monitoring & Evaluation sector showcases a diverse range of roles, each contributing to the effectiveness and impact of aid programs. This 3D pie chart illustrates the distribution of prominent roles in the UK market. Roles like Monitoring & Evaluation Officer and Humanitarian Data Analyst lead the sector, representing 45% and 25% respectively. Disaster Management Specialist and Humanitarian Program Manager positions account for 15% and 10% of the market share. The MEAL (Monitoring, Evaluation, Accountability, and Learning) Coordinator role, although smaller, plays a critical part in the sector with 5%. Organizations increasingly demand data-driven decision-making and accountability, fostering a strong demand for professionals with skills in Monitoring & Evaluation, Data Analysis, and Program Management. By understanding these job market trends and skill demands, aspiring professionals can make informed decisions when pursuing a career in Humanitarian Monitoring & Evaluation.
